    A letter of reference is written by someone who knows you (a 'referee') and will give details of your character, your standard of work, your attitudes etc etc.. . It is best if you choose people who know you from an academic viewpoint, and perhaps one person who knows you from an out-of-school activity.. . One of your referees should be your principal/headteacher. All should be adults, preferably with professional qualifications.. . No referee should be a member of your family, or a close personal friend.. . References are usually confidential, and you probably will never see the letters.. . It is courteous and sensible to ask the people concerned if they are happy to act as your referees before putting their names down on the form.
